译者|刘汪洋审校|重楼如今,分布式版本控制系统,例如Git,在版本控制领域已然成为主流。有人认为,使用像Git这样的版本控制系统(VCS)进行分支和合并非常便捷。但我更推崇基于主干的开发(TBD),现在我将解释其中的原因。在基于主干的开发模式中,所有开发人员都在同一个分支(例如'main')上工作。你可能已经从 MartinFowler 或 DaveFarley 那里了解过相关讨论。当Git迅速成为首选版本控制系统时,通过与Dave的合作经历,我亲身体验到了团队在持续交付环境中基于主干开发所带来的优势。与此不同,分支模型则鼓励开发人员为每个特性、错误修复或增强功能创建独立的分支。虽然分支在隔离
?本篇内容:YOLOv5/v7/v8改进最新主干系列BiFormer:顶会CVPR2023即插即用,小目标检测涨点必备,首发原创改进,基于动态查询感知的稀疏注意力机制、构建高效金字塔网络架构,最新TransFormer改进结构:BiFormer重点:???YOLOv5|YOLOv7|YOLOv8使用这个创新点在数据集改进做实验:即插即用BiFormer????本博客内附的改进源代码改进适用于YOLOv5、YOLOv7、YOLOv8…等等YOLO系列按步骤操作运行改进后的代码即可?此论文为刚录用的CVPR2023顶会:BiFormer,适合用来写最新的改进?论文表示BiFormer在小目标检测的
摘要设计一个高效但易于部署的3D主干来处理稀疏点云是3D目标检测中的一个基本问题。与定制的稀疏卷积相比,Transformers中的注意力机制更适合于灵活地建模长距离关系,并且更易于在现实世界应用中部署。然而,由于点云的稀疏特性,在稀疏点云上应用标准Transformer是非常重要的。因此本文提出了动态稀疏体素Transformer(DSVT),这是一种用于室外3D目标检测的基于单步窗口的体素Transformer主干。为了有效地并行处理稀疏点云,论文提出了动态稀疏窗口注意力,它根据稀疏性在每个窗口中划分一系列局部区域,然后以完全并行的方式计算所有区域的特征。为了允许跨集合连接,论文设计了一种
我刚刚上传了一个新的CocoaPod,但当我在CocoaPod.org上搜索时它没有出现。它需要多长时间才能显示在搜索结果中? 最佳答案 如果是第一次,我已经花了3小时到24小时。第一次需要永远。更新速度更快,通常会在2-3小时内完成。 关于swift-新的自定义CocoaPod需要多长时间才能上传到pod主干?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/41702187/
CSP-Darknet530.引言1.网络结构图1.1输入部分1.2CSP部分结构1.3输出部分2.代码实现2.1代码整体实现2.2代码各个阶段实现3.代码测试4.结论0.引言CSP-Darknet53无论是其作为CVBackbone,还是说它在别的数据集上取得极好的效果。与此同时,它与别的网络的适配能力极强。这些特点都在宣告:CSP-Darknet53的重要性。关于原理部分的内容请查看这里CV经典主干网络(Backbone)系列:CSPNet1.网络结构图具体网络结构可以参考YOLOV3详解(一):网络结构介绍中使用的工具来进行操作。具体网址和对应的权重文件下载地址如下:模型可视化工具:ht
预期的输入和输出:a->aa.txt->aarchive.tar.gz->archivedirectory/file->filed.x.y.z/f.a.b.c->flogs/date.log.txt->date#Mine!这是我觉得很脏的实现:>>>frompathlibimportPath>>>example_path=Path("August082015,01'37'30.log.txt")>>>example_path.stem"August082015,01'37'30.log">>>example_path.suffixes['.log','.txt']>>>suffixes
一、HTTPS主干-分支第一层第一层,是主干的主干,加密通信就是双方都持有一个对称加密的秘钥,然后就可以安全通信了。问题就是,无论这个最初的秘钥是由客户端传给服务端,还是服务端传给客户端,都是明文传输,中间人都可以知道。那就让这个过程变成密文就好了呗,而且还得是中间人解不开的密文。第二层这才涉及到非对称加密这个事。非对称加密有两种方式,公钥加密私钥解密,私钥加密公钥解密。服务端把它的公钥发给客户端,然后客户端用公钥把要传给服务端的对称加密的秘钥加密。此时传递的就是加密的数据了,而且只能服务端用私钥才能解开,中间人无法得知。因为秘钥传输既怕别人看到,也怕别人篡改。但此时的公钥已经不怕别人看到了,
我有一个绑定(bind)到模型的表单:用户表单,由Backbone.View.extend表示,它具有:model:userView内部:events:{'click#payment':'updatePayment'}付款是一个html选择:paypalcheckupdatePayment:function(){varpayment=this.$("#payment");console.log(payment);}遗憾的是,付款没有值(value)。有人可以帮忙吗?谢谢! 最佳答案 这有点难说......但看起来你想要这个:even
我有一个绑定(bind)到模型的表单:用户表单,由Backbone.View.extend表示,它具有:model:userView内部:events:{'click#payment':'updatePayment'}付款是一个html选择:paypalcheckupdatePayment:function(){varpayment=this.$("#payment");console.log(payment);}遗憾的是,付款没有值(value)。有人可以帮忙吗?谢谢! 最佳答案 这有点难说......但看起来你想要这个:even
如果说当下最火的AI技术和话题是什么,恐怕很难绕开ChatGPT。各大厂商都在表示未来要跟进ChatGPT技术,开发在自然语言处理智能系统,可见其影响力。本篇博客追个热度,来简单的介绍下ChatGPT到底是一项什么技术,究竟如何完成复杂的语言处理任务的。ChatGPT到底是一项什么技术如果想要了解ChatGPT是一项什么技术,不如直接问问他:可以看到ChatGPT是一项基于Transformer模型实现的NLP软件。关于Transformer模型,我们已经在之前文章《注意力机制原理概述》介绍过。这里提到的LM技术,其实就是Transformer。ChatGPT背后的Transformer架构那